Gifts of the Spirit: This is a study of the purpose and place of the ministry of the Holy Spirit in the church and marketplace, along with practical instruction on cooperating and flowing with the Spirit, which enables the student to become a vessel He can use.

Ministering in the Prophetic: The nature and calling of the Biblical prophets will be studied. As well as, the role of the prophetic in the church today. Students will learn to minister in revelatory gifts as the Spirit leads through principles and practice.

Prayer and Intercession: This is a presentation of the foundational importance of prayer in the life of every believer, which will also discuss the varied aspects of prayer, intercession, and travail.

Signs and Wonders: with Special Emphasis on the Healing Ministry: This focuses on the foundations of the Old Testament and the fulfillment and practical outworking of the ministry of the miraculous in the New Testament.

The "Sozo" Ministry: This curriculum developed by Forerunner Ministries will explore the inner workings of Jesus' ministry of salvation, healing and deliverance in students' personal lives. It will also involve training the students to minister using these truths.



GRADUATION REQUIREMENTS

To be eligible to receive a Certificate of Completion, students must meet the following criteria:
1. Satisfactorily complete two years of course requirements (including reading 8-10 books while in school of outside reading).
2. Participation in outreach and in-reach ministry bi-weekly.
3. Class attendance requirements fulfilled.
